Understanding the Market: Real vs. Fake Autographs
In the digital age, the global marketplace for autographed memorabilia has expanded rapidly. Unfortunately, this growth has been paralleled by an influx of counterfeit items. Distinguishing between real autographs and forgeries is a critical skill for any collector. To uncover the secrets of authenticity, start by familiarizing yourself with the signature of the athlete in question. The Importance of Certificates of Authenticity (COA)
One of the most effective ways to verify the authenticity of a signed sports item is through a Certificate of Authenticity (COA). A legitimate COA serves as an assurance from an authoritative verifier, confirming that the autograph is genuine. Always prioritize items accompanied by a COA from well-respected organizations in the memorabilia industry. Tips for Buying Signed Collectibles Online
- Research: Always do your homework on the athlete's signature pattern and common signs of authenticity.
- Certification: Ensure the item comes with a Certificate of Authenticity from a reputable source.
- Documentation: Purchase items that include photo evidence or proof of the signing event.
